1. RTP (Return to Player): 95.1%

With an RTP of 95.1%, players can expect to receive back 95.1 coins for every 100 coins wagered. This implies that the casino retains a 4.9% edge, which is relatively standard for online slots. While this RTP is close to the industry average, it is not particularly high. Therefore, players should be aware that over time, they could experience losses that align with this theoretical return.

Simple Expected Return Calculation:

If a player spins 1,000 times with a bet of €1 (a typical midrange outlay, total wager = €1,000):

1,000 * 0.951 (RTP) = €951 returned

Expected loss = €49

This scenario emphasizes that while there is a projected return aligned with RTP, actual experiences may vary widely due to the game's variability.
